Signs It May Be Time to Downsize

One of the clearest indicators that it may be time to downsize is when your home feels larger than necessary for your daily needs. Many homeowners find themselves maintaining unused bedrooms, oversized living areas, and large outdoor spaces that require significant upkeep. This extra space often comes with higher utility costs, property taxes, and maintenance expenses that may no longer be practical. In addition, life transitions such as retirement, becoming empty nesters, or seeking a more manageable lifestyle often trigger the desire to move into a smaller property. Recognizing these changes early allows home sellers to plan their transition thoughtfully instead of reacting to sudden circumstances.

Downsizing can provide significant financial benefits for home sellers who are ready to transition to a smaller property. Selling a larger home often unlocks valuable home equity that can be used to purchase a smaller home outright, reduce debt, or strengthen retirement savings. Lower mortgage payments, decreased property taxes, and reduced maintenance expenses can also improve monthly cash flow. Many homeowners discover that downsizing allows them to redirect money toward travel, hobbies, or other lifestyle goals they may have postponed. When approached strategically, selling a larger home can provide both immediate financial relief and long-term financial security.

How Market Timing Impacts Downsizing Decisions

The real estate market plays an important role in determining the ideal time for home sellers to downsize. In a strong seller’s market, limited inventory and high buyer demand can lead to multiple offers and higher sale prices. This can significantly increase the amount of equity a homeowner walks away with when selling their property. At the same time, sellers should evaluate local housing inventory to ensure suitable downsizing options are available when they are ready to purchase their next home. Monitoring housing trends, interest rates, and neighborhood demand can help sellers choose the most favorable time to list their home.

Preparing Your Home for a Successful Downsizing Sale

Preparing your home properly before listing it can significantly impact the success of your downsizing strategy. Home sellers should begin by decluttering, organizing belongings, and addressing any minor repairs that could affect buyer perception. A well-maintained and clean home often attracts more interest and can lead to stronger offers. Many sellers also choose to stage their home to highlight its best features and help buyers visualize the space more effectively. Taking these proactive steps not only increases the home’s appeal but also helps streamline the transition to a smaller property.
